And like I asked before, is the system with servers the same before? If there are 10-20 servers at the beginning, how will you even manage to get 5000 people on it?

Server files will be available to everyone on release, servers will automatically be automatically approved to connect to the central hive (You won't need to wait/apply for an instance ID and wait for support to whitelist the IP like the mod). They have also made arrangements for surge hosting to bridge the gap between release and people setting their own servers.
